The Crib Stage: Safety First
0 to 6 months
In the first few months, a crib remains a foundation of a baby's environment. Safety is paramount during this stage, where elements such as picking a baby crib that meets current safety requirements can considerably affect an infant's wellness.
Vital Considerations
- Crib Design and Safety Standards: Look for cribs that comply with modern-day security requirements, avoiding drop-side cribs or those with features that may pose security dangers.
- Mattress Selection: A firm, well-fitting mattress is vital for avoiding suffocation and guaranteeing convenience.
- Bed linen Choices: Opt for fitted sheets without pillows, blankets, or toys in the baby crib to lessen dangers.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
What kind of cot is best for a newborn?
A safe, strong baby crib that satisfies the most recent safety requirements is important. Look for a product without drop sides and guarantee the mattress fits comfortably.
When should I shift my kid from a baby crib to a toddler bed?
Many children transition to a toddler bed between 18 months and 3 years, though readiness can depend on the kid's advancement and behavior.
How can I guarantee my home is safe for a crawling baby?
Install security gates at stairs, safe heavy furnishings, cover electrical outlets, and remove any choking hazards from the floor to produce a safe environment.
